Edmonton police have a new digital ally in keeping vulnerable detainees safe in the cell between arrest and bail, the first of its kind in Canada .
In-cell biometric monitoring comes in with the help of a wireless medical vital-sign monitoring device.
In the year the biometric sensors have been in place, EPS hasn’t had any fatalities within cells.
In August 2024 , biometric monitoring saved the life of a female detainee in custody.
Regina and Medicine Hat and a few agencies in Ontario have the system, and Lethbridge and Calgary are working on it.
The devices are $ 3,000 apiece per unit, and licensing fees are about $2,500 per unit.
